WebA distributed snapshot algorithm captures a consistent global state of a distributed system. A global state can be described by a cut that indicates the time at which each process \checkpoints" its local state and messages. WebApr 22, 2015 · The global-state-detection algorithm is to be superimposed on the underlying computation: it must run concurrently with, but not alter, this underlying computation. If we can take a snapshot of the state of a distributed system, then we can test that state with a predicate ( y) – for example, “is the system deadlocked.”.
